India will soon step up its push for next-generation weapons and military platforms, with a Parliamentary Committee recommending a dedicated budget head for research into “critical and latest technologies”, including hypersonic missiles, sixth-generation fighter jets and supersonic glide weapons.
The recommendation was made to ensure that funding for these projects is not delayed and that their development is taken up on a priority basis.
In its report, the Committee noted that the Defence Research and Development Organisation (DRDO) is working on next-generation military technologies amid rapid advances in defence systems worldwide.
The panel said Advanced Medium Combat Aircraft (AMCA) is being developed as a fifth-generation fighter, while work is also being planned for sixth-generation fighter aircraft. These aircraft are expected to be network-centric and integrated with other military platforms and ground-based systems.
A key focus area identified by the Committee is the development of Supersonic Glide Missile systems, which combine supersonic or hypersonic speeds with the ability to glide and manoeuvre after launch.
According to the report, these characteristics make such weapons extremely difficult to detect and intercept.
The panel recommended adequate funding, time-bound development milestones and testing infrastructure for research into glide missile technology. It said indigenous development in the field would be important for the nation’s preparedness as warfare increasingly relies on networked systems.
The Committee said a dedicated allocation for critical and emerging technologies would help avoid funding bottlenecks and ensure timely implementation of strategic defence projects.
The report also noted that developing capabilities in these areas would support future platforms, including next-generation combat aircraft and unmanned systems.
Meanwhile, the Ministry of Defence told the Committee that DRDO’s work on hypersonic technologies is progressing.
The ministry said hypersonic weapons and missiles travel at speeds of Mach 5 or more and at low altitudes. “They are also highly manoeuvrable making them nearly impossible to intercept with current defence systems,” the ministry said.
The government further said such weapons can reduce an adversary’s decision-making and reaction time, allow attacks from unexpected directions and use high kinetic energy to penetrate hardened targets.
